Understanding the Basics of Cryptocurrency Trading

In recent years, cryptocurrency has become a popular investment option thanks to the soaring prices of Bitcoin, Ether, and other digital currencies. Trading cryptocurrencies involves buying and selling these currencies on crypto exchanges and taking advantage of price fluctuations. Cryptocurrency trading can be lucrative, but it involves a high level of risk and requires a deep understanding of financial markets and the underlying technology. Before investing in cryptocurrency, it’s important to understand its fundamentals, including the concept of blockchain, market trends, and strategies for managing risk. Effective Cryptocurrency Wallet Management

To trade cryptocurrencies, you need a digital wallet that securely stores your coins. A cryptocurrency wallet is a software program that allows you to interact with the blockchain network and manage your digital assets. When selecting a wallet, make sure that it’s compatible with the cryptocurrency you want to trade and is secure and easy to use. Different types of wallets have different features and security levels. For example, hardware wallets offer better security than software wallets but are less user-friendly. Whatever wallet you choose, it’s important to keep your private keys safe and not share them with anyone.

The Role of Technology in Crypto Trading

Technology plays a crucial role in cryptocurrency trading. Platforms such as exchanges, trading bots, and charting tools provide traders with valuable insights into market trends and allow them to execute trades more effectively. Crypto exchanges are online platforms where buyers and sellers can trade cryptocurrencies for other assets or fiat currencies. They typically charge a small commission on all trades. Trading bots are automated algorithms that use machine learning and artificial intelligence to analyze market data and execute trades. Charting tools, meanwhile, provide real-time market data and allow traders to visualize price movements and identify patterns.

Managing Risk in Cryptocurrency Trading

Cryptocurrency trading involves a high level of risk, and it’s essential to develop effective strategies for managing that risk. One approach is to diversify your portfolio by investing in multiple cryptocurrencies and using different trading strategies. Another is to set stop-loss orders that automatically sell your assets if their value drops below a predetermined level. You should also keep an eye on market trends, news, and regulatory developments that may affect cryptocurrency prices.

Innovations in Cryptocurrency Trading and Wallet Management

The cryptocurrency industry is constantly evolving, and new technologies are emerging to improve the efficiency and security of crypto trading and wallet management. One promising innovation is decentralized exchanges (DEXs), which allow users to trade cryptocurrencies directly with one another without the need for intermediaries. Another is non-fungible tokens (NFTs), which are digital assets that can represent a wide range of unique items, such as art, collectibles, and even real estate. There are also new wallet solutions that offer enhanced security and convenience, such as multi-signature wallets that require multiple private keys to access funds, and mobile wallets that allow you to manage your assets on the go.

The Future of Cryptocurrency Trading and Wallet Management

Cryptocurrencies have the potential to revolutionize the way we think about money and financial transactions. As the industry continues to mature and more people adopt cryptocurrencies, we can expect to see continued innovation in crypto trading and wallet management. Governments and regulatory bodies may also play a more significant role in shaping the future of cryptocurrencies, with some already implementing rules and policies to regulate trading and prevent fraud. Regardless of how the industry evolves, it’s clear that cryptocurrency trading and wallet management will continue to be essential skills for anyone interested in the world of finance.
